The Respiratory Care Program at Acuity Hospital of Houston is designed to provide a comprehensive interdisciplinary approach for complete respiratory care to patients with pulmonary disorders. The Respiratory Program is directed by experienced and dedicated physicians, from the Texas Medical Center. Our pulmonologists design a plan to meet each patient's individual needs. The physician component of the respiratory team includes Ear, Nose, and Throat physicians that oversee airway management and Internal Medicine Physicians that monitor the patient's complex medical needs.
One of our key focuses is the ventilator weaning program. We realize that no two patients are the same, so our ventilator weaning and management programs are very patient specific. The Respiratory Program goal is to advance our patients to their optimal level of health and independence through proven clinical pathways.
